Rejected petition Let GCSE English exams have copies of the text.
GCSE Students have to remember poems, parts of books... Kids study other subjects and have to remember other things. How are they expected to remember so much?
More details
A-Level have a open book exams. They study less text than GCSE students and do less subjects. If GCSEs are becoming harder why are A-levels becoming easier? This generation already have enough stress on them. They won't be able to remember formulas, equations, case studies and now different texts.
